Panel wattage: The wattage of a solar panel determines how quickly it can supply energy. If the panel’s wattage is high, it can send energy to the battery more quickly, and vice versa. For example, a 100-watt supply charges faster than a 30-watt panel, assuming similar conditions. Battery capacity.

How long does a 100 watt solar panel take to charge?
Turns out, 100 watt solar panel will take about 9 peak sun hours to fully charge a 12v 100ah lead acid battery from 50% depth of discharge. how fast should you charge your battery? Deep cycle or solar batteries are designed to charge and discharge at a specific rate, which is referred to as the c-rating.
How many watts a solar panel to charge a battery?
You need around 360 watts of solar panels to charge a 12V 100ah Lithium (LiFePO4) battery from 100% depth of discharge in 4 peak sun hours with an MPPT charge controller. What Size Solar Panel To Charge 50Ah Battery?

How much power does a 100W solar panel generate?
Hence, your panels will generate anywhere from 100W x 3 hours = 300 watt-hours or 100W x 5 = 500 watt-hours per day. Ideally, a 100W panel should charge 1 battery at a time. This is because the panel’s output is limited, and adding more batteries will lengthen the charging time.
What is a good charge rate for a solar panel?
Typical efficiency ranges from 15% to 22%. Determines how fast the battery can be safely charged. A C-rate of 0.5C means the battery can be charged in 2 hours. Cloudy weather, high temperatures, or poor sunlight reduces solar panel output, increasing charging time. Lithium-ion, AGM, or Lead Acid batteries have different charge acceptance rates.
